Verdict

Piła is cheaper overall. A single-person monthly budget in Piła runs about $658 versus $874 in Warsaw — a difference of roughly 33%.

Salary-adjusted, Warsaw leaves more disposable income after basic expenses. Both figures are model estimates — see each city page for local-currency detail.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Piła cheaper than Warsaw?
Yes. A single person spends an estimated $658 per month in Piła versus $874 in Warsaw — about 33% less.
How far is Piła from Warsaw?
The straight-line distance between Piła and Warsaw is approximately 306 km (190 miles).
Which city has better salaries, Piła or Warsaw?
The estimated average net salary is $1,500 in Piła and $1,950 in Warsaw. After living costs, a single person keeps roughly $842 in Piła versus $1,076 in Warsaw per month.
